What is AWS SpotUsage:m5.large?

Last updated: April 10, 2025

The amount of running hours of EC2 Spot Instances. Spot Instances offer savings of up to 90% over On-Demand Instances but can be interrupted by AWS when the capacity is needed.

The postfix represents the instance type, m5.large.

Available Regions The prefix represents the region.
Line Item Region
APN1-SpotUsage:m5.large Asia Pacific region in Tokyo, Japan
APN2-SpotUsage:m5.large Asia Pacific region in Seoul, South Korea
APS1-SpotUsage:m5.large Asia Pacific region in Singapore
APS2-SpotUsage:m5.large Asia Pacific region in Sydney, Australia
APS3-SpotUsage:m5.large Asia Pacific region in Mumbai, India
CAN1-SpotUsage:m5.large Canada region in Central Canada
EU-SpotUsage:m5.large Europe (Regional Designation)
EUC1-SpotUsage:m5.large Europe region in Frankfurt, Germany
EUS1-SpotUsage:m5.large Europe region in Milan, Italy
EUW2-SpotUsage:m5.large Europe region in London, United Kingdom
EUW3-SpotUsage:m5.large Europe region in Paris, France
SAE1-SpotUsage:m5.large South America region in São Paulo, Brazil
SpotUsage:m5.large US East region in Northern Virginia
USE2-SpotUsage:m5.large US East region in Ohio
USW2-SpotUsage:m5.large US West region in Oregon
